A 20kg child moving at 3.0m/s tangentially jumps onto the edge of a merry-go-round at rest. The merry-go-round has a mass of 250kg and a radius of 2.25m. Assume the merry-go-round behaves as a uniform disk and the child behaves as a point mass. Determine the angular velocity immediately after the child lands in revolutions per minute. A) 0.86
B) 1.76
C) 2.17
D) 3.85
E) 5.29
